Edward Ferrell, Brig. Gen. Dawn M. Ferrell's father, and Brig. Gen. David McMinn, commander of the Texas Air National Guard, pin on her new rank during her promotion ceremony Jan. 15, 2016, in the Texas Capitol's Senate Chambers. Texas Gov. Greg Abbott appointed Ferrell as the Deputy Adjutant General - Air for the Texas Military Department's Texas Air National Guard. Ferrell is the first female to hold the rank of general officer in the TXANG.

U.S. Rep. Will Hurd (TX-23) (left) visits with Brig. Gen. David M. McMinn, commander of the Texas Air National Guard, and Brig. Gen. Dawn M. Ferrell. Texas’ deputy adjutant general for air, in his Capitol Hill office in the Cannon House Office Building, in Washington, March 2, 2016. McMinn and Ferrell were requested to provide an update on the 273rd Information Operations Squadron, a subordinate unit of the 149th Fighter Wing, based at Joint Base San Antonio-Lackland, Texas, which has been selected to become an Air National Guard Cyber Protection Team and recently completed a site activation visit as they transition toward becoming a cyber operations squadron.

Brig. Gen. David M. McMinn, commander of the Texas Air National Guard, hands the organization’s flag to Command Chief Master Sgt. Marlon Nation, the organization’s command chief master sergeant, during a ceremony recognizing McMinn’s appointment as commander at Camp Mabry, in Austin, Texas, Jan. 23, 2016. McMinn is a command pilot with more than 5,000 flight hours in multiple military aircraft, including the C-130 Hercules.
